What is Bio Data Form?

A bio data form is a document that provides detailed information about an individual's personal and professional background. It is often used in various settings such as job applications, college admissions, and marriage proposals. The bio data form typically includes details such as name, contact information, educational qualifications, work experience, skills, and references.

What are the types of Bio Data Form?

There are different types of bio data forms available depending on the purpose and requirements. Some common types include:

Job Application Bio Data Form
Marriage Proposal Bio Data Form
College Admission Bio Data Form
Scholarship Application Bio Data Form

Biodata stands for biographical data and a biodata resume is typically used in select countries to help arrange employment and suitable marriages. Student's educational biodata refers to information about a student. It reflects the student's level of education. You may be required to provide this information when seeking admission into institutions of learning. Schools may also require students to provide their biodata for documentation.
A biodata is an abbreviation of biographical data and a biodata form is the text document that collects that data. This form collects information that can include name, gender, place of residence, educational qualifications and professional accomplishments.

Follow these steps to write an effective biodata: Include a formal photograph of yourself. Add a personal statement outlining your background and career objectives. Provide some basic personal information. Share your educational background. Share your work experience. List out any awards or recognitions you have received.
